San Marino in Brazil for ETC promotion projects

Brazil - Europe Travel Marketplace 2024

The Republic of San Marino took part in the "Brazil - Europe Travel Marketplace 2024" organized by the European Travel Commission for the promotion of some European tourist destinations on the Brazilian market. The roadshow, organized with the aim of promoting the peculiarities of the San Marino territory and tourism on the most prestigious of the South American markets, was lead by the Director of the Tourism and Culture Department and Ambassador of the Republic of San Marino in Brazil Filippo Francini and by the Head of the Marketing Sector of the San Marino Tourism Board Franca Rastelli Tourist.

Local contact for European Travel Commission were Petr Lutter Director of ETC Brazil and Director for South America of the Tourism Board of the Czech Republic and Miguel Nieto Sandoval, Deputy Director of ETC Brazil and Director of the Spanish Tourism Board in Brazil.

Alongside the numerous sessions scheduled with the press and tour operators, institutional meetings and guided tours had also been organised.

Director Filippo Francini met the Secretary of State for Tourism of Rio de Janeiro Gustavo Tutuca and the Secretary of State for Tourism of Sao Paulo Roberto De Lucena. The excellent relations between San Marino and Brazil were confirmed with both in the year in which we celebrate the 40th anniversary of the start of official relations and it was agreed to continue the work of joint promotion as per the Memorandum of Understanding signed by the ministers of tourism of the two countries in Dubai on the occasion of Expo2020.

Among the prestigious meetings also the one with the Italian Consul General Domenico Fornara and with the Secretary of the Government of the State of San Paolo Gilberto Kassab.

The visit to the Ayrton Senna museum, a motoring legend closely linked by destiny to the Republic of San Marino, was particularly touching.
